Sakura Dental Clinic sits in the quiet residential pocket of Kitami, Setagaya — not a flashy area, but exactly the kind of neighborhood dental clinic that locals actually trust. They handle the full range of general dentistry: cleanings, fillings, crowns, extractions, implants, and orthodontics. Nothing exotic, but solid and thorough.
English capability here is conversational — staff can get through a basic appointment without you needing to mime tooth pain. Don’t expect fluent clinical explanations, but they’ve clearly dealt with foreign patients before and aren’t thrown off by it. Some English materials are available, which is more than most local clinics in the area offer.
This is a good fit if you live in western Setagaya or commute through Kitami Station on the Odakyu Setagaya Line. It’s a neighborhood clinic with real staying power — not a tourist-facing practice, which honestly means they’re used to building ongoing relationships with patients rather than one-off visits.
Patient Feedback
Patients tend to describe thorough examinations without feeling rushed, which is notable for a local clinic. The dentist takes time to explain what’s happening, even across a language gap. Wait times are generally reasonable if you book ahead. The atmosphere is calm and low-pressure — no upselling energy. It’s a neighborhood practice that feels like one, which regulars seem to genuinely appreciate.
